AI Content Pipeline

An example publishing workflow that prepares briefs and drafts for a human editor.

OpenAI Claude n8n SEO
Automation

AI Content Pipeline

01 / Challenge

The challenge

An article passes between research, drafting, editing, and publishing. When the handoffs are unclear, editors spend time collecting material before they can edit.

02 / Approach

The proposed approach

The workflow separates the brief, draft, coverage check, and publishing preparation. A human editor reviews the article before it goes live.

03 / Aim

The intended benefit

Editors would begin with an organised draft and supporting notes. Review time and the number of usable drafts would help measure the benefit.

Workflow

How this workflow could run.

  1. Step 01

    Turn keyword and audience notes into structured content briefs.

  2. Step 02

    Draft each section using the brief and source material.

  3. Step 03

    Check that drafts cover the topic, answer the search query, and read clearly.

  4. Step 04

    Prepare copy, metadata, and a checklist for the editor.
